Technical SEO for eCommerce: The Foundation of Online Success

In the bustling world of eCommerce, where thousands of new online stores pop up every day, standing out is more challenging than ever. You’ve got your products, a beautiful website design, and a solid marketing plan. But what if your store is a masterpiece hidden in a vault? This is a reality for many businesses that overlook a critical piece of the puzzle: Technical SEO.

Think of your eCommerce website like a high-tech sports car. On-page SEO is the sleek paint job and luxurious interior, the stuff users see and interact with. Off-page SEO is the reputation and accolades you’ve earned on the race circuit. But technical SEO? That’s the engine, the transmission, and the wiring, the unseen components that make the car run at peak performance. Without a well-tuned engine, even the most stunning car won’t win races. For an online store, a faulty “engine” means search engines can’t properly find, understand, or rank your pages. This leads to a loss of visibility, a poor user experience, and, most importantly, lost sales.

This guide will demystify the world of technical SEO for eCommerce. We’ll explore why it’s not just a nice-to-have but a non-negotiable part of your online strategy. We will break down every essential component, from site speed to structured data, and provide a clear roadmap to ensure your digital storefront is built on a solid, searchable foundation.

The Critical Role of Technical SEO for eCommerce

Technical SEO is not a one-time task; it’s an ongoing process of optimizing your website’s backend for both search engines and user experience. For eCommerce, where site size and complexity are often high, this optimization is vital. Here’s a deep dive into the most important aspects.

Technical SEO for eCommerce: The Foundation of Online Success

1. Site Speed and Core Web Vitals

In the world of online shopping, patience is a scarce commodity. Research has shown that even a one-second delay in page load time can lead to a significant drop in conversions and page views. Google and other search engines have made page speed a major ranking factor through a set of metrics known as Core Web Vitals.

  • What are they? Core Web Vitals are three specific metrics that measure a page’s loading performance, interactivity, and visual stability.
    • Largest Contentful Paint (LCP): Measures how long it takes for the main content of a page to load. Aim for under 2.5 seconds.
    • First Input Delay (FID): Measures the time from when a user first interacts with a page (e.g., clicking a link) to when the browser is able to respond. A good score is less than 100 milliseconds.
    • Cumulative Layout Shift (CLS): Measures unexpected shifts of content on a page as it loads. A low CLS score means the page is visually stable.
  • How to improve them? Optimizing images is a major factor. This includes compressing images, using modern file formats (like WebP), and lazy-loading non-critical images. Minifying CSS and JavaScript files, using a Content Delivery Network (CDN), and upgrading your web hosting can all significantly boost your store’s speed.

2. Mobile-Friendliness and Responsive Design

A massive portion of eCommerce sales now happen on mobile devices. If your website is not optimized for smaller screens, you’re not only losing potential customers but also hurting your organic rankings. Google’s mobile-first indexing means they primarily use the mobile version of a site for indexing and ranking.

  • What to check? Ensure your site has a responsive design that automatically adapts to any screen size. Buttons should be easy to tap, text should be readable without zooming, and navigation should be intuitive. Test your site with Google’s Mobile-Friendly Test tool to identify any issues.

3. Site Architecture and Internal Linking

A well-organized site structure is like a clear roadmap for both search engines and users. A logical hierarchy helps search bots understand the relationship between different pages and distributes “link equity” (or authority) throughout your site.

  • How to structure it? The best practice is a “pyramid” or “silo” structure. Your homepage is at the top, followed by broad category pages, then subcategories, and finally, individual product pages.
  • Internal linking: Make sure related products, categories, and blog posts are all linked together. This helps users navigate and encourages search engines to crawl more of your site. Breadcrumb navigation is a simple but effective way to improve both user experience and internal linking. It creates a clear path from the homepage to the current page.

4. Crawlability and Indexability

A search engine’s “crawl budget” is the number of pages it will crawl on your site. For large eCommerce sites with thousands of products, managing this budget is essential. You want search engines to spend their time on your most important pages, not on irrelevant, outdated, or duplicate content.

  • Robots.txt: This file tells search bots which pages they can and cannot crawl. You can use it to block irrelevant pages like checkout carts, login pages, or internal search result pages.
  • XML Sitemaps: A sitemap is a list of all the important URLs on your site that you want search engines to crawl and index. Submitting an XML sitemap to Google Search Console helps ensure that no important page is missed.
  • Noindex tags: You can use a “noindex” meta tag on pages you don’t want to appear in search results, such as filtered product pages with many parameters, which often create duplicate content issues.

5. Structured Data (Schema Markup)

Structured data is code you add to your website to help search engines better understand its content. It can lead to rich results in the search engine results pages (SERPs), like star ratings, product prices, and stock availability. These visually appealing results can dramatically increase click-through rates.

  • Product Schema: This is one of the most important types of schema for eCommerce. It provides detailed information about your products directly to search engines, making your listings more informative and enticing.
  • Other Schemas: Other useful schemas include reviews, local business information, and FAQ markup, all of which can enhance your presence in the SERPs.

6. HTTPS and Website Security

Website security is a major ranking factor. An SSL certificate enables HTTPS, which encrypts the data transferred between a user’s browser and your site. Google prefers secure sites and may warn users if a site is not secure.

  • Why is it important? Beyond the SEO benefits, HTTPS builds trust with your customers. They are more likely to make a purchase when they know their personal and payment information is safe.
  • Fixing “mixed content”: An audit can reveal “mixed content” issues where some assets (like images or scripts) are still loading over insecure HTTP connections on an otherwise secure HTTPS site. Fixing these issues is crucial for security and user trust.

7. URL Structure and Canonicalization

A clean, descriptive URL structure is better for both users and search engines. A URL like yourstore.com/category/product-name is much clearer than yourstore.com/id=12345.

  • Canonical Tags: eCommerce sites often have duplicate content issues. For example, a single product might be accessible through multiple URLs (e.g., yourstore.com/t-shirts/product-x and yourstore.com/sale/product-x). Canonical tags tell search engines which URL is the “master” or preferred version, preventing issues where search engines get confused and dilute the SEO value of your pages.
URL Structure and Canonicalization

Conclusion

Technical SEO is the often-invisible hero of eCommerce. It works behind the scenes to ensure your website’s foundation is solid, secure, and ready to perform. By focusing on site speed, mobile-friendliness, and a logical site structure, you are not only satisfying search engine algorithms but also creating a flawless shopping experience for your customers. When technical SEO is done right, it amplifies the impact of all your other marketing efforts. It’s the difference between a storefront on a bustling main street and one hidden in a dark alley.

Don’t let technical issues hold your business back. A comprehensive technical SEO audit and a strategic plan are the first steps toward unlocking your store’s true organic potential.

Ready to grow your business?

Contact Finch today to learn how our performance marketing experts can help you build a robust online presence that drives real, measurable results.

FAQs about Technical SEO

Q: What is the main difference between technical SEO and on-page SEO for an eCommerce site?

A: The primary difference lies in where the optimizations are applied. Technical SEO focuses on the website’s backend infrastructure and code, the non-content elements. This includes things like site speed, crawlability, security (HTTPS), and structured data. It ensures search engines can efficiently find and understand your site. On-page SEO, on the other hand, deals with the content and user-facing elements on a page. This includes optimizing product descriptions, titles, meta descriptions, and image alt text with keywords. Both are crucial, but technical SEO provides the foundational structure that allows your on-page efforts to be effective.

Q: Why is site speed so important for eCommerce specifically?

A: Site speed is critical for two main reasons: user experience and search engine ranking. From a user’s perspective, a slow site is frustrating and often leads to a high “bounce rate” where a potential customer leaves the site before making a purchase. Studies show that a one-second delay can significantly hurt conversions. From a search engine’s perspective, fast-loading sites are rewarded with higher rankings. Google’s algorithms see speed as a signal of a high-quality, user-friendly website. For eCommerce, where every second could mean a lost sale, a fast site is directly tied to your bottom line.

Q: What is a crawl budget, and why do I need to worry about it for my online store?

A: A crawl budget is the number of pages a search engine bot (like Googlebot) will crawl on your website within a given time frame. For large eCommerce sites with thousands of products and filtered category pages, this budget can be easily wasted on unimportant pages, like user login screens or product filter URLs that create duplicate content. By using tools like robots.txt and noindex tags, you can tell search engines to ignore certain pages, thus directing their crawl budget toward your most valuable pages (product pages, categories, and blog content) that you actually want to rank.

Q: How can structured data help my eCommerce site stand out?

A: Structured data, or schema markup, is code you add to your HTML to provide rich context to search engines about your products and services. For eCommerce, this is particularly powerful. By using “Product” schema, for example, you can tell search engines the product’s name, price, availability, and review ratings. This information is then used to create “rich snippets” in the search results, visually enhanced listings that often include star ratings, prices, and images. These eye-catching snippets can dramatically increase your organic click-through rate (CTR) because they stand out from standard text listings.